2013-05-08 3 views
0

в railstutorial chap.6, когда я пытаюсь перенести я получаю эту ошибку:RailsTutorial Chap 6, Грабли Aborted

MacBook-Pro-de-Stephane-Cedroni:sample_app stephanecedroni$ bundle exec rake db:migrate 
== AddIndexToUsersEmail: migrating =========================================== 
-- add_index(:users, :email, {:unique=>true}) 
    -> 0.0020s 
== AddIndexToUsersEmail: migrated (0.0022s) ================================== 

rake aborted! 
An error has occurred, this and all later migrations canceled: 

SQLite3::BusyException: database is locked: commit transaction/Users/stephanecedroni/.rvm/gems/ruby-1.9.3-p392/gems/sqlite3-1.3.5/lib/sqlite3/database.rb:97:in `close' 

ли у кого-то такая же ошибка? Я не очень экспериментировал, нужна ваша помощь!

Thanks

+0

Возможный дубликат: http://stackoverflow.com/questions/78801/sqlite3busyexception – Raindal

+0

попытался исправить это, но не работает. –

ответ

1

У меня была та же проблема.

У меня было другое открытое окно консоли, в котором я запускал «rails console --sandbox», поэтому я запретил любые изменения в моей базе данных. После закрытия этого окна я мог бы выполнить миграцию.

Возможно, это поможет!